我有一个脚本将值附加到2个表中。执行脚本时显示错误

时间:2018-05-07 05:29:15

标签: sql sql-server sql-insert

  

消息2601,级别14,状态1,过程Trig_InsertToInvoiceDetails,   第45行无法在对象中插入重复的键行   'dbo.TT_InvoiceDetails'具有唯一索引'idx_Invdtl'。重复   关键值是(152245,2018 / 03 / IC17-334,135)。声明一直如此   终止。

但我传递的只是唯一值

1 个答案:

答案 0 :(得分:0)

有2个案例

  1. 针对唯一索引'idx_Invdtl'there已经保存行的值为152245,2018 / 03 / IC17-334,135)

  2. 其次,您的保存过程效果不佳,它会传递相同的值进行保存。